Ray Harryhausen, the legendary special-effects master whose influence was felt both in his sci-fi and fantasy movies as well as in the works of later filmmakers such as George Lucas and Peter Jackson has died at the age of 92.
His family announced his death in London Tuesday via The Ray and Diana Harryhausen Foundation Facebook page.
Inspired by the original 1930s King Kong, Harryhausen made monsters come alive and thrilled audiences in the 20th century with a variety of movies such as Mighty Joe Young, Jason and the Argonauts and Clash of the Titans.
